What is a Single Way Switch Wiring Diagram?

A Single Way Switch Wiring Diagram is a visual representation that shows how to connect a single-pole, single-throw (SPST) switch to a power source and a load, typically a light bulb or an outlet. This type of switch has two terminals and acts like a gatekeeper for electricity. When the switch is in the 'on' position, it closes the circuit, allowing electricity to flow to the load. When it's in the 'off' position, it opens the circuit, interrupting the flow of electricity.

The primary purpose of a Single Way Switch Wiring Diagram is to guide the user through the correct connection of wires. It typically shows the incoming power (live and neutral wires), the switch itself, and the connection to the device being controlled. The proper understanding and application of this diagram are essential for electrical safety and preventing electrical hazards. Without it, incorrect wiring could lead to short circuits, fires, or damage to appliances.

Here's a breakdown of the common components and their roles, as depicted in a typical Single Way Switch Wiring Diagram:

  • Live Wire (Hot Wire): This is the wire that carries the electrical current from the power source.
  • Neutral Wire: This wire provides a return path for the electrical current back to the power source.
  • Switch: The device that interrupts or completes the electrical circuit. It has two terminals for connecting wires.
  • Load: The device that consumes electricity, such as a light fixture, fan, or outlet.

Here's a simplified representation of the flow:

Component Function
Power Source Supplies electricity (live and neutral)
Live Wire Carries current to the switch
Single Way Switch Controls the flow of current
Wire to Load Carries current from the switch to the load
Neutral Wire Provides return path for current
Load Operates when circuit is complete
